The Wedding of Felicity Huffman & William H. Macy

Who: "Desperate Housewives" star Felicity Huffman and actor William H. Macy ("Fargo")

When: September 6, 1997

Where: The couple were united in matrimony on the groom's family estate in Woody Creek, Colorado.

The Ceremony: Two photographers captured the occasion for posterity in both color and black and white as the bride and groom slipped bands of gold upon each other's ring fingers and pledged their eternal devotion through self-penned vows during an outdoor ceremony witnessed by 180 guests. At the conclusion of the service, the newly dubbed husband and wife walked up the aisle to the jubilant beat of James Brown's "I Feel Good."

The Dress: The groom later confessed that he became misty eyed when he saw his bride walk toward him in a Mon Atelier ivory peau de soie gown. A halo of silk blossoms attached to Felicity's blonde locks harmonized with her bouquet, a composition by florists Aspen Branch of pale pink roses, baby blue delphinium, hydrangeas and anemone.

In keeping with the event's blue theme, Felicity's 11 bridesmaid's donned indigo dresses by American designer Nicole Miller, whose creations are a red carpet favorite with such celebrities as Paris Hilton, Britney Spears and Angelina Jolie. Dainty pearl stud earrings and Mon Atelier chiffon stoles, gifts from the bride, completed the look.

The pristine white of the groom's Mon Atelier wool gabardine suit, reminiscent of the Colorado snow which blankets the ground of his Woody Creek home each winter, was offset with a blue cornflower boutonniere.

The Reception: Guests including Camryn Mannheim of "The Practice" and Kristen Johnston of "3rd Rock From The Sun" dined on food prepared by the chefs at the Hotel Jerome, one of Aspen's premier establishments, beneath a white tent erected on the grounds of the estate. Nature's beauty was brought inside with centerpiece arrangements comprised of hydrangeas, blue delphiniums and anemone interspersed with ivy.
